# Heads up for security review: we pin every dependency of the Quillbase
# client to exact versions, including transitive ones, via the lockfile in
# ./pins. Policy is: no floating ranges, no "latest", and upgrades land as
# their own PR with a diff of the resolved tree. Yes, it's tedious, but it
# means this client setup below is reproducible byte-for-byte. The client
# authenticates to the internal Quillbase registry on init, so it needs a
# service key at construction time. That key is the following.

app token of bahaf-tajeg = zpat23_SjjsllwiLmXbtS65veZaV47

[ ] Key ceremony step 4 — Pagination sanity check. Support folks: before we rotate the Larkspan API keys, hit the public catalog endpoint and confirm cursor pagination still returns a next-page token on every full page. If customers report missing tokens mid-ceremony, that's the rotation, not a bug — just note it. Once pagination checks out, unlock the ceremony binder using the recovery passphrase below.

vault phrase of fahog-yajog = frawyn-jordor-casael-gormir-olieth-julmir

## Changelog — Textgrove upload defaults

Encoding detection defaults changed in Textgrove 2.9. Uploaded text files are now sniffed with the new detector before falling back to UTF-8; the old Latin-1 fallback is removed. Files with BOMs are honored unconditionally. Detection confidence below threshold triggers a reject instead of a silent transcode. Affects all ingest paths, including the bulk importer. The detector ships with these defaults.

settings of kagag-kagef:
[kelath]
port = 9300
region = west-4
host = kelath.olvarqworks.example
team = sorion
timeout_ms = 1000
retries = 8

Quarterly Planning Note — Shift to Annual Billing

Sales leads: beginning next quarter, Torvane Analytics moves all new Skylume subscriptions to annual billing by default. Monthly plans remain available only with regional approval. Early pilots in the Harwick territory showed a 14% uplift in retained revenue. Update your proposal templates and train teams on the revised discount ladder before the cutover date. Commission mechanics are unchanged. The confidential plan detail this supports is set out below.

board note of kageg-bahof: The renewal with Holwynax Holdings closes at $2 million a year, 5 percent below the last contract. Project Ulaath slips by two quarters because of the supplier delay.